  13. Delete both win_x64 and win_x86 folders in C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\Euro Truck Simulator 2\bin then verify your game cache from Steam.

  17. If you have high CPU usage then it means that your CPU is not fast enough and possibly could bottleneck your GPU. High GPU usage on the other hand is good to be high because that means the game fully utilizes the card which means you get maximum FPS out of the card. Also don't forget, the usage in general will be higher since you will meet more trucks/players at the same area than you would in SP.
